Does the wind turbine have a substation

A step-up substation is typically built in every wind farm to collect all the energy generated by turbines and received through MV cables. However, new or existing wind farms can be upgraded to absorb this energy. What Is the Role of a Substation in a Wind Farm? A substation in a wind farm serves as the central hub for collecting, converting, and transmitting the. . The onshore substation transforms power to grid voltage, for example up to 400 kV. It also provides switchgear to protect the grid from the wind farm, and vice versa, for fault conditions. [pdf]
